如果 HellGPT 安装后启动失败,不用着急,可以按“先做最容易的事,再做复杂的事”的顺序排查:先重启、以管理员权限运行、检查网络和杀软拦截,再看日志文件和错误码。常见成因包括缺少运行时库、显卡/CUDA 驱动不匹配、端口被占用、配置或缓存损坏,以及应用与操作系统权限或防火墙冲突。按步骤执行定位后,通常能在短时间内恢复;如果卡住了,记录完整日志交给技术支持会大大加快解决速度。

先简短说清楚原理(像向朋友解释)
把应用想象成一辆车:安装是把零件装好,启动是点火和检查车能否行驶。如果“车”没启动,可能是钥匙(运行时库)不对、燃油(显卡/驱动)不足、线路短路(防火墙或权限)或发动机内部出问题(配置/缓存损坏)。我们要做的就是按顺序排查这些部位,从容易、低风险的步骤开始,这样最快找到并修好问题。
快速优先级清单(先做这些)
- 重启电脑/手机:很多临时占用或冲突仅需重启解决。
- 以管理员/根权限运行:右键“以管理员身份运行”或在 macOS/Linux 使用 sudo。
- 检查杀毒与防火墙:暂时禁用或允许 HellGPT 的可执行文件和端口。
- 确认磁盘空间与内存:模型或缓存文件可能需要较大空间。
- 查看日志:日志里往往直接写明是什么错误。
按平台详细排查步骤
Windows
按部就班来做,别一次尝试太多以免混淆结果。
- 任务管理器:查看是否有 HellGPT 进程挂起(Ctrl+Shift+Esc)。结束进程再重试。
- 以管理员权限运行:右键可执行文件 → 以管理员身份运行。
- 事件查看器:打开“事件查看器”→Windows 日志→应用,查找与 HellGPT 相关的错误或 .NET/其它运行时报错。
- 缺失运行库:常见提示如 VCRUNTIME140.dll、MSVCP140.dll。安装 Visual C++ Redistributable(2015-2022)通常能解决。
- 端口与服务:若应用需要本地服务,运行 cmd:netstat -ano | findstr :端口号,确认端口未被占用。
- 日志位置:常见在 %APPDATA%\HellGPT 或 %LOCALAPPDATA%\HellGPT\logs,查最新 log 文件。
- 显卡驱动:若使用本地模型或 GPU 加速,更新 NVIDIA/AMD 驱动,确认 CUDA/cuDNN 版本兼容。
macOS
- 活动监视器:查看是否有僵尸进程。杀掉重启应用。
- 以终端运行可执行文件:/Applications/HellGPT.app/Contents/MacOS/basename,终端会打印即时日志,方便定位。
- 系统日志:打开 Console(控制台),筛选 HellGPT 或相关时间段的错误。
- 权限问题:检查“系统偏好设置→安全性与隐私→隐私”,确认麦克风、文件访问等权限是否需要授予。
- Homebrew/依赖:如果使用 Homebrew 安装的库(Python、OpenSSL 等),确认版本兼容。
Linux(桌面与服务器)
- systemd 服务:若安装为服务:sudo systemctl status hellogpt.service;查看 journalctl -u hellogpt -f。
- 直接运行:在终端里直接运行可执行文件或启动脚本,观察标准输出和错误输出。
- 查看日志目录:通常在 /var/log/hellogpt、~/.config/HellGPT 或安装目录下的 logs。
- 依赖包:检查 Python 虚拟环境、Node.js、libc、OpenGL 或 CUDA 等依赖是否缺失。
- 权限与 SELinux/AppArmor:临时放宽策略或查看 audit 日志,确认安全模块未阻止启动。
Android / iOS
- 兼容性:确认系统版本满足应用要求(Android 版本、iOS 版本)。
- 重装与清缓存:设置→应用→HellGPT→清除缓存/清除数据,或卸载后重装。
- 应用权限:确认所需权限(麦克风、存储、网络)已允许。
- 崩溃日志:Android 使用 adb logcat,iOS 使用 Xcode 的设备日志来抓取崩溃信息。
常见错误信息与快速对应措施
| 错误/日志片段 | 可能原因 | 推荐操作 |
| 无法加载 VCRUNTIME140.dll | 缺少 Visual C++ 运行时 | 安装 Visual C++ Redistributable(2015-2022)并重启 |
| CUDA 初始化失败 / cuDNN 版本不兼容 | 显卡驱动或 CUDA/cuDNN 与应用要求不匹配 | 更新驱动或安装匹配的 CUDA/cuDNN,参考 HellGPT 文档的版本要求 |
| 端口绑定失败: Address already in use | 端口被其他程序占用 | 修改配置文件的端口或结束占用进程(netstat/lsof) |
| 权限被拒绝(EACCES / Permission denied) | 文件或目录无写入/读取权限 | 调整权限,或以管理员/根用户运行 |
| 应用崩溃但无明显错误 | 配置损坏、缓存错误或第三方冲突 | 备份配置,删除配置/缓存重启,或回滚到干净配置 |
如何查看和理解日志(最有用的步骤)
日志是修问题最直接的线索,像医生看体检单一样。找到最近的日志文件,按时间倒序看报错(ERROR / FATAL),把第一个出现的异常当作起点。常见的信息有堆栈跟踪(stack trace)、错误码、缺失的文件路径或权限拒绝的系统调用。
- 找到日志后,用文本编辑器或 tail -f 实时跟踪。
- 把出现的第一条异常信息完整复制;如果有 stack trace,复制前后几行上下文。
- 如果日志显示缺少某个库或文件,先确认该文件是否存在以及路径权限。
收集诊断信息以便技术支持
如果自己无法解决,联系技术支持时提供下面信息会大大提高响应效率:
- 操作系统与版本(例如 Windows 11 22H2 / Ubuntu 22.04 / macOS 13.4)。
- HellGPT 版本号(安装包名或安装时间),安装方式(安装程序/包管理器/源码)。
- 完整的启动日志文件(或至少出现错误的片段)。
- 如果涉及 GPU,提供显卡型号、驱动版本、CUDA/cuDNN 版本。
- 执行过的主要排查步骤(重启、清缓存、以管理员运行等)。
- 若出现错误码或异常堆栈,直接粘贴文本而非截图更方便分析。
谨慎但实用的“彻底重装”流程(最后手段)
彻底重装前先备份用户数据(自定义词库、历史翻译、配置文件等)。步骤示例:
- 备份配置目录(Windows: %APPDATA%\HellGPT 或 %LOCALAPPDATA%\HellGPT;macOS/Linux: ~/.config/HellGPT 或 ~/Library/Application Support/HellGPT)。
- 卸载应用(通过控制面板/卸载脚本),并手动删除残留目录。
- 清理系统缓存(Windows 可用磁盘清理或手动删除临时文件)。
- 重新下载安装与安装必须的运行库(Visual C++ / .NET / Python 依赖等)。
- 安装后先不要恢复旧配置,先运行空白配置确认可启动,再逐项恢复定制设置以确认哪项导致故障。
预防建议(避免下次再犯)
- 定期备份:配置、用户词库和重要日志定期拷贝。
- 更新节奏:更新驱动、CUDA 与系统时,先看应用兼容性说明。
- 保持日志可用:开启详细日志选项以便出现问题时有线索。
- 不要一次改太多:升级或改配置时循序渐进,便于回滚定位问题。
备注:如果你看到“授权、激活或许可证”相关提示
这类问题通常与网络访问、时间同步或授权服务器有关。先确认系统时间准确,网络可访问授权服务器域名(或暂时关闭代理/VPN),若离线授权,按文档使用离线激活流程。若激活失败,准备好授权码、安装 ID 与日志一并联系售后。
小结式提示(但不做正式总结)
总的来说,按“重启→权限→防护软件→日志→驱动/依赖→重装”这个顺序排查,大多数启动失败都能被定位。如果卡在某一步,别急着全面重装,先把日志和失败步骤准备好发给技术支持;常常只需一条关键错误信息就能把事情迅速解决。就像修车一样,先看仪表盘,再听发动机的声音,最后拆开检查部件。
如果你愿意,可以把出错时的第一条日志贴过来,我帮你看下最可能的原因,或一步步引导你跑命令并解读返回信息。